    Today In Braves History: March

    March 1st:

    2005: The Braves and Tim Hudson agree to a four year extension worth $47 million.

    March 9th:

    2011: During a Spring game at Lake Buena Vista, Braves minor league coach Luis Salazar is struck in the face by a line foul drive off the bat of Brian McCann. Salazar would lose his left eye and suffer a concussion.
